Transaction 5b305193fa8a1637bf07fe7c20b3d518c2ab49f0f0def66457f78952ecb0d849

1 Input
2 Outputs
  • 5b305193fa8a1637bf07fe7c20b3d518c2ab49f0f0def66457f78952ecb0d849:0
  • value  65338257
    address  174HnJ8nzQPyHpEapUxSRL7x4EE58pHiau
  • 5b305193fa8a1637bf07fe7c20b3d518c2ab49f0f0def66457f78952ecb0d849:1
  • value  1027939
    address  1KXaQB5ws75J9gqiNizuEcftzJkJHa1qZC